About the Author
Howard E. Wasdin is a retired United States Navy SEAL and author of the book "SEAL Team Six". Born in 1961, Wasdin grew up in Florida and joined the Navy at age 18. He went on to complete Basic Underwater Demolition/SEAL (BUD/S) training and became a member of SEAL Team Two before being selected for SEAL Team Six, also known as the Naval Special Warfare Development Group (DEVGRU). During his time with DEVGRU, Wasdin participated in numerous high-profile missions including Operation Desert Storm and was awarded the Silver Star for his bravery.
After serving 12 years as a Navy SEAL, Howard E. Wasdin retired from active duty due to injuries sustained during a mission in Somalia that was later depicted in the movie "Black Hawk Down". Despite facing physical challenges, he completed his undergraduate degree at University of South Alabama and then earned his Doctorate of Chiropractic from Life University. In addition to writing "SEAL Team Six", he has also authored two other books about his experiences as a Navy SEAL: "I Am A Seal Team Six Warrior" and "The Last Rescue".
